Office Market Cologne Q1 2026
BNP Paribas Real Estate's Q1 2026 review of Cologne's office market reports floor turnover of 45,000 square meters, down 33 percent year-over-year and 24 percent below the long-term average, attributed to challenging macroeconomic conditions and prolonged leasing processes. Prime rents remained stable at 33.50 euros per square meter while average rents rose 3.9 percent year-over-year to 21.40 euros per square meter, with vacancy increasing to 515,000 square meters (6.5 percent of total stock) and pre-leasing of new construction at a high 73 percent, though market activity is expected to recover through the remainder of 2026 given numerous large tenant inquiries in process.
